Leather, originating from various animal hides, has long been a favored material in fashion and upholstery. However, the process of manufacturing leather products results in considerable waste—including scraps, shavings, and off-cuts. Historically, the disposal of this waste has caused environmental concerns, as leather is not biodegradable and often ends up in landfills, contributing to pollution.
A variety of traditional recycling methods have been used extensively to manage leather waste. These include:
Landfilling: While this is the most common method, it does not offer a sustainable solution. Leather can take decades to decompose, contributing to soil contamination and methane emissions.
Incineration: Some facilities choose to burn leather waste. Although this method generates energy, it also releases harmful pollutants into the atmosphere, potentially impacting air quality.
Recycling into products: Traditional recycling involves processing leather waste into lower-quality products, such as artificial leather or insulation materials. While this method reduces the overall waste, it may not fully utilize the material's inherent characteristics.
The Leather Waste Briquette Machine represents a significant leap forward in the recycling of leather waste. This innovative piece of equipment compresses leather scraps into dense briquettes, which can be used as fuel or raw material for other applications.
Resource Efficiency: By transforming leather waste into briquettes, this machine enables more efficient usage of material that would otherwise be discarded.
Reduced Environmental Impact: Briquette production diminishes the volume of leather waste sent to landfills and minimizes emissions associated with other disposal methods, such as incineration.

Economic Benefits: In the long run, businesses can save costs by converting waste into marketable products. The briquettes can be sold or used in-house, reducing overall expenses related to waste management.
Versatility: These briquettes can be used in various applications beyond energy production, including specific manufacturing processes and even as components in construction materials.
